Transaction 09158be24a2df4071b3c7f068f33b507d117866aab07fc7a22af76e2a5d7aa5b
1 Input
2 Outputs
- 09158be24a2df4071b3c7f068f33b507d117866aab07fc7a22af76e2a5d7aa5b:0
- 09158be24a2df4071b3c7f068f33b507d117866aab07fc7a22af76e2a5d7aa5b:1
value 63456904
address 176xKcdGsA1EaDcpHquNVZvnTwDrUQkNxa
value 34272000
address 14X9qH1owDsnrDq6toEDjCsPNiAdrj7T4r